UAE Dental Consumables Market Executive Summary

The UAE Dental Consumables Market is at around $169 Mn in 2023 and is projected to reach $308.9 Mn in 2030, exhibiting a CAGR of 9.0% during the forecast period 2023-2030.

Dental consumables refer to a wide range of products and materials that are used in dental practices and procedures. These consumables are essential for providing dental care and treatment to patients. Dental consumables play a pivotal role in ensuring the delivery of high-quality care and promoting optimal oral health for patients. These consumables encompass a diverse range of products and materials that are integral to various aspects of dental practice, from routine examinations and preventive care to complex restorative and surgical procedures. At the forefront of dental consumables are the instruments and hand tools that dentists and hygienists rely on daily. Dental consumables are a broad range of products and materials used in dental practices for various purposes related to oral health care. They include dental instruments like mirrors, probes, and scalers for examination and cleaning; dental materials such as composites, cements, and impression materials for restorative treatments and fabricating dental appliances; preventive products like floss, brushes, and fluoride agents for promoting oral hygiene and cavity prevention; disposables like bibs, suction tips, and gloves for infection control; restorative materials like crowns, bridges, and implants for replacing missing teeth; and pharmaceuticals like anaesthetics, antibiotics, and analgesics for pain management and treating infections. These consumables are indispensable tools in modern dentistry, enabling dentists to diagnose and treat dental issues, restore tooth structure and function, maintain oral health, ensure patient comfort and safety, and provide comprehensive dental care to patients of all ages.

According to a recent survey by health authorities, around 85 per cent of children in Dubai suffer from dental caries by the time they reach 12 years old. The survey also found that 72 per cent of children in Dubai have gingivitis, which is a form of gum disease. The market therefore is driven by significant factors like growing dental care needs, technological advancements, expanding dental infrastructure, increasing disposable incomes, public health initiatives, dental tourism, rising consumption of sugary and starchy foods, rise in unhealthy eating habits due to rising urbanization, changing living standards etc.

Market Dynamics

Market Drivers

Rising dental tourism: The UAE has emerged as a popular destination for dental tourism, attracting patients from neighbouring countries and regions due to its advanced dental facilities and skilled professionals. This influx of dental tourists has boosted the demand for dental consumables.

Increasing oral health awareness: With rising awareness about oral hygiene and the importance of preventive dental care, more people in the UAE are seeking regular dental check-ups and treatments, driving the demand for dental consumables, thus driving the growth of the market.

Increased prevalence of dental problems: Factors such as poor dietary habits, lifestyle choices (e.g., smoking), and age-related dental issues have contributed to an increase in the prevalence of dental problems among the UAE population. According to a recent survey by health authorities, around 85 per cent of children in Dubai suffer from dental caries by the time they reach 12 years old. The survey also found that 72 per cent of children in Dubai have gingivitis. This has led to a higher demand for dental treatments and, consequently, dental consumables.

Market Restraints

High costs of dental treatments: Dental treatments can be relatively expensive in the UAE, which may discourage some individuals from seeking regular dental care, thereby limiting the demand for dental consumables.

Shortage of skilled dental professionals: Despite the influx of dental tourists, the UAE faces a shortage of skilled dental professionals, which can limit the growth of the dental consumables market.

Import dependency: The UAE relies heavily on imported dental consumables, which can be affected by fluctuations in exchange rates, supply chain disruptions, or trade regulations.

Regulatory Landscape and Reimbursement Scenario

The Health Authority Abu Dhabi is responsible for regulating and overseeing the healthcare sector in Abu Dhabi. HAAD sets standards for healthcare providers, including dental clinics, and ensures that they comply with regulations related to quality of care, patient safety, and licensing. Dubai Health Authority (DHA) is responsible for regulating and overseeing the healthcare sector in Dubai. DHA sets standards for healthcare providers, including dental clinics, and ensures that they comply with regulations related to quality of care, patient safety, and licensing.

The Ministry of Health and Prevention (MOHAP) is responsible for setting healthcare policies and standards at the federal level in the UAE. MOHAP regulates healthcare providers across the country and is responsible for approving new drugs and medical devices.

The UAE government has launched the National Oral Health Program, which aims to promote oral health awareness and provide access to oral care services for all UAE residents. The program focuses on preventive measures, such as regular dental check-ups and oral health education.

In the UAE, dental insurance coverage is not yet widespread, which can make it difficult for patients to afford dental treatments and procedures. However, some employers do offer health insurance plans that include dental coverage, which can help to offset the cost of dental care.

The Dubai Health Authority (DHA) has recently launched a new initiative called the Dubai Dental Outpatient Clinic (DDOC), which aims to provide affordable dental care to UAE residents. The DDOC provides a range of dental services, including preventive care, restorative dentistry, and cosmetic dentistry, at reduced rates. Additionally, some dental clinics in the UAE offer financing options for patients who cannot afford to pay for their treatments up front. These financing options allow patients to pay for their treatments in instalments over time, making it easier for them to manage the cost of dental care.
